Ludlow is a suburb of Springfield with a population of 21,050. Ludlow is in Hampden County. Living in Ludlow offers residents a sparse suburban feel and most residents own their homes. In Ludlow there are a lot of parks. Many young professionals and retirees live in Ludlow and residents tend to lean liberal. The public schools in Ludlow are above average.
